I have a 95 EX with the standard SOHC VTEC.. Now i know in order to see big HP gains, go boost or swap. I feel i dont have the knowledge yet for the boost, and i dont have the funds yet for the swap. I have some standard bolt on's AEM short ram, cat-back 2 3/4, performance chip (unkown - came with the car -), DC sports 4-2-1 header, (uninstalled) I need to know if there are any other ways that I can up the Horespower?? Any ideas would be appericated greatly.. thanks

coupe or hatch first off? Secondly...save up money. How fast you want to go is directly correlated with how much you are willing to spend. If you have a hatch, keep it. Coupe? Too heavy to be fast without alot of money into it, haha. I own a coupe. It is still slow even with a b18c5 in it.

As I have learned from Rocket;

the secret of flow; good intake, good TB, good intake manifold, good headwork, good exhaust manifold, 2.5" exhaust all the way back.
